Transaction 41107148042baac99e5b52a20dd4488184d756ef4a37c423f6ccd25ed4689734
1 Input
1 Output
-
41107148042baac99e5b52a20dd4488184d756ef4a37c423f6ccd25ed4689734:0
- value
- 476759
- script pubkey
- OP_0 OP_PUSHBYTES_32 46a809d6cbf6001a34b4657eab02912d9c749247a7025f492ed76e5a066ffb5d
- address
- bc1qg65qn4kt7cqp5d95v4l2kq539kw8fyj85up97jfw6ah95pn0ldwscyk4pt